3.2
MACHINE INSTALLATION
1. Remove the machine from the skid and lift the machine onto the vehicle with the
discharge end of the machine toward the rear of the vehicle.
2. Securely mount the machine to the bed of the vehicle using ½” (12mm) diameter
bolts as shown in the diagram on page 12.
3. Pass the remote control unit through an open window and locate it within reach of
the person operating the machine. If permanent vehicle installation is desired, the
remote control cable can be fed through a clearance hole in the vehicle chassis and
then reconnected. When drilling clearance holes, ensure that all sharp edges are
removed and covered to prevent premature wearing of the remote cable. When
routing the cable to the vehicle cab, do not allow the cable to be exposed to any
sharp edges. Avoid sharp bends when routing the cable.
4. Once the cable has been routed to the cab, reseal all drilled openings to prevent
moisture and/or exhaust gases from entering the cab.
